Quick LinksQuick Facts about Spirit Of The Gold Coast Whale WatchingWhale Watching Reviews & Stories The boat leaves around 9.30am (boarding at 9.00am) from Berth D19 at Marina Mirage, Main Beach. This is the lower pontoon on the right hand side when walking out from the open air car park between Marina Mirage Shopping Centre and Mariners Cove. Beware, if you take the upper pontoon (the left hand one) by the time you realise you will have to walk all the way back!
About This Gold Coast Whale Watching Tour OperatorThe Spirit Of The Gold Coast Whale Watching group have been running whale watching tours for over 17 years, the last 7 out of the Gold Coast. Prior to that they ran whale watching tours from Port Stephens, Coffs
Harbour and Coolangatta. They have a record of 99% plus sightings so you can be fairly confident you will see whales! Although the 24m catamaran can take up to 170 passengers into open waters, they limit the passengers to 145 during whale watching season to ensure that viewing is good for everyone.
